New exco for Middle Belt Lawyers Forum
Mr. Emmanuel Haruna has been elected chairman of the interim executive committee of the Middle Belt Lawyers Forum (MBLF) while Mr. Elachi Agada will serve as Secretary of the new group.
Their election follows the inaugural meeting of the organisation on October 19, this year at the Nostalgla Hotel and Suites, Lokoja, Kogi State.
A communiqué by the group after their meeting reads in part: "That there be established a body to be called Middle Belt Lawyers Forum. This forum shall be open to lawyers who are from all states in the middle-belt zone. The states are, Kwara, Benue, FCT, Abuja, Kogi, Nasarawa, Niger, and Plateau states. That the forum is established as a group within the Nigerian Bar Association with the objective of promoting and pursuing the welfare and collective interest of the forum."
It added: "That the forum shall have a council of elders, which shall comprise the following: All Attorneys-General of the respective states, all Senior Advocates of Nigeria from the member-states, all members of the body of benchers from the member states, and one senior member of the bar elected/nominated from each state and the FCT. That the forum as established shall have a body referred to as the general council I which shall be the representative council for all lawyers from the relevant states and the FCT.
"That the general council shall be constituted as follows: all members of the interim executive of the forum, all members of the council of elders of the forum, all chairman and secretaries of branches within the forum, all members of the NEC of the NBA from each state and the FCT in the forum, and five members elected/nominated from each branch within the forum. Where a branch/state hosts a meeting of the forum, 10 members of the branch /state shall be nominated to and allowed to attend the meeting of the forum as observers.
"That an interim executive committee be constituted to, among other things, do the following: run all the affairs of the forum, prepare a constitution for the forum, register the forum, conduct elections for a substantive leadership of the forum. The interim committee shall have a period of three years on the path of growth."
Other executive are: First Vice Chairman, S.P. Dashi; Assistant Secretary, Shuaibu Yakubu; Welfare Secretary, Joshua Wepdiyel; Legal Adviser, Debo Adeyemo and ex-officio-Prof M. A. Akanbi.
